Owner report 10056143 · 2004-01-29 (January 29, 2004)

CONSUMER WAS SHIFTING THE GEARS AND NOTICED SMOKE COMING FROM THE REAR. THIS CAUSED THE MOTORCYCLE TO STALL. CONSUMER WAS ABLE TO DRIVE THE MOTORCYCLE TO THE DEALER FOR INSPECTION, AND MECHANIC DETERMINED THAT GEAR SHIFT PATTERN INDICATOR NEEDED TO BE REPLACED. *AK

Owner report 10062989 · 2004-04-20 (April 20, 2004)

ON JANUARY 9, 2004 CONSUMER RECEIVED A RECALL LETTER REGARDING THE TRANSMISSION. DEALERSHIP STILL DID NOT HAVE THE PARTS AVAILABLE TO CONDUCT RECALL REPAIRS. THE DEALER WAS CONTACTED AND INDICATED THAT THE CONSUMER SHOULD WAIT UNTIL MAY 2004. *AK *NM
